Redeeming Digital Credits
To redeem digital credits on Amazon, follow these steps:
- Sign in to your Amazon account.
- Click on the “Your Account” tab.
- Select “Digital content and devices” from the menu bar.
- Click on the “Redeem gift card or code” link.
- Enter the claim code for your digital credit in the provided field.
- Click the “Redeem” button.
Once you have redeemed your digital credit, it will be added to your Amazon account balance. You can then use this balance to purchase eligible digital content, such as apps, books, movies, and music.

Troubleshooting Issues with Credits
If you’re having issues redeeming or using your Amazon Digital Credits, there are a few troubleshooting steps you can take:
1. Check the Availability of Your Credit
Ensure that your digital credit is active and hasn’t expired. Log into your Amazon account and go to “Your Account” > “Digital Credit” to verify your credit’s status.
2. Check for restrictions
Not all Amazon Digital Credits are eligible for use on all purchases. Check the terms and conditions of your credit to ensure it can be used for the item you’re trying to purchase.
3. Confirm Your Payment Method
If using a gift card or credit card to purchase items with your digital credit, ensure the payment method is still valid and has sufficient funds.
4. Update Your Device’s Software
Outdated software can sometimes cause issues with redeeming digital credits. Check for any available software updates for your device.
5. Clear Your Browser’s Cache
If using Amazon’s website, clearing the browser’s cache can sometimes resolve issues with redeeming digital credits.
6. Restart Your Device
A simple device restart can sometimes fix temporary issues that may be preventing you from redeeming your digital credit.
7. Contact Customer Support
If none of the above steps resolve your issue, contact Amazon’s customer support for further assistance.
8. Report Fraudulent Activity
If you believe your digital credit has been used fraudulently, report it to Amazon immediately. They will investigate the incident and take the necessary action.
9. Redemption Issues
For specific issues with redeeming digital credits, refer to the following table for troubleshooting steps:
Issue | Troubleshooting Steps |
---|---|
Redemption Code Not Working | Verify that the code is entered correctly. Check for any typos or spaces. |
Credit Not Applied to Purchase | Confirm that the credit is active and eligible for use on the item. Check if the purchase total exceeds the credit amount. |
Delay in Credit Redemption | Wait up to 24 hours for the credit to reflect in your account. If the delay persists, contact Amazon’s customer support. |
